1. What is the Average Window Tinting Cost by Car Type?
The average window tinting cost varies by vehicle type. Professional window tinters estimate costs between $99 to $850 for complete car tinting. The price depends on the car type, film quality, and shop location.
- Sedans: $250-$650
- Coupes: $120-$450
- Trucks: Around $350
- SUVs: $250-$750
- Teslas: $250-$935
The price range is broad because of different film types, locations, and shop rates.
2. How Much Does It Cost to Tint Windows on Sedans (4-Door Cars)?
The cost to tint windows on sedans (4-door cars) can vary widely based on the type of window film you choose. Selecting the right film can enhance your driving experience.
- Affordable Tint (e.g., Carbon Tint): Expect to pay around $50 per window or about $250 for all seven windows (two front sides, two back sides, two rear quarter windows, and the rear window).
- Higher-End Tints (e.g., Ceramic Tint): You might pay around $100 per window or about $650 for all seven windows.

3. How Much to Tint Coupe Windows?
Tinting coupe windows can be more expensive, especially for models with steep rear or curved windows. These designs require more skill and time, thus increasing labor costs. The average cost to tint a two-door car with five windows ranges from $120 to $450.
4. What is the Cost to Tint Truck Windows?
The cost to tint truck windows generally averages around $350. This price can fluctuate depending on the truck’s size, which affects the amount of material and labor needed. If you opt to tint the slider windows, the price will likely increase.
5. How Much Does It Cost to Tint SUV Windows?
Tinting SUV windows typically costs between $250 and $750. SUVs have more and larger windows, impacting material and labor costs.
6. What is the Tesla Window Tinting Cost?
Tesla window tinting costs vary depending on the model (Model S, Model 3, Model X, or Model Y) and the number of windows tinted. Prices range from $250 to $935 for all-around tint.

7. What is the Cost for a Tint Job by Type of Film?
The cost of a tint job depends heavily on the type of film. Quality ceramic tints cost more than affordable dyed alternatives. Material and technology determine the average price. Here’s a closer look at the three main types of automotive window film and their unique benefits.
- Ceramic Window Tint: $350 – $850
- Dyed Window Tint: $99 – $350
- Carbon Window Tint: $150 – $450
8. Ceramic Window Tint Cost: Is It Worth It?
Ceramic window film is the highest quality, containing ceramic particles without metal or dye. These non-metallic and non-conductive particles don’t block cell signals, GPS systems, or radios. However, ceramic window tint is the most expensive because of its advanced technology, costing between $350 and $850.

9. Dyed Window Tint Cost: A Budget-Friendly Option?
Dyed window tint is the most affordable option for car windows. It uses a dye added to a layer next to the adhesive applied to the windows. This tint fades faster from the sun’s UV rays, eventually turning purple, brown, or completely transparent.
Dyed window tint is cheap because it doesn’t use advanced technology to improve performance. Its poor durability and common bubbling problems require more frequent replacements than ceramic tint. Expect to pay between $99 and $350 for dyed tint.
10. Carbon Window Tint Cost: The Middle Ground?
Carbon tint contains carbon particles that effectively block infrared light, keeping interiors cooler. The film resists fading compared to dyed films and doesn’t contain metal, avoiding cell phone and radio transmission issues. However, the carbon can create glare and haze, affecting visibility. Carbon window tint costs between $150 and $450.

11. What Other Window Tinting Cost Factors Should You Consider?
Several other factors can affect the price of professionally tinted windows. These include the number and complexity of windows, the warranty offered, and the location and local laws.
12. How Do the Number and Complexity of Windows Impact Cost?
The cost depends on the number, size, and type of windows you want to tint. Some windows are harder to tint, requiring extra time even for experienced tinters. Cars like the VW Beetle, Corvette Z06, and Audi A8 have complex windows that increase labor costs.
13. How Does the Warranty Affect Window Tinting Prices?
Warranty is another significant factor. Some films, like Rayno Phantom, offer a lifetime warranty, while others have shorter warranty periods. A longer warranty can justify a higher initial cost.
14. How Do Location and Laws Influence Window Tinting Costs?
Tint costs vary significantly by city and state. Areas with high demand might charge more, but more competition can also lead to better deals. Get quotes from at least three locations to compare options and pricing.
Additionally, state laws dictate legal VLT% (Visible Light Transmission) for windows, limiting tint options.
15. Can You Save Money with DIY Window Tinting?
DIY window tinting using a tint installation kit can be a more affordable option, but consider the drawbacks.
Applying DIY window tint requires specific tools and skills. Even with detailing experience, a good application isn’t guaranteed. DIY tinting kits must comply with state limits. Increased bubbling risks can force you to restart the process.

17. FAQs About Window Tinting Costs
Q1: What is the average cost to tint all the windows on a sedan?
A1: The average cost ranges from $250 to $650, depending on the type of tint film used.
Q2: How much does it cost to tint the front windshield?
A2: Front windshield tinting can range from $100 to $400, depending on the film type and local regulations.
Q3: Is ceramic tint worth the extra cost?
A3: Yes, ceramic tint offers superior heat rejection, UV protection, and durability, making it a worthwhile investment.
Q4: Can I tint my car windows myself to save money?
A4: While DIY tinting is cheaper, it requires specific skills and tools, and mistakes can lead to bubbling and poor results.
Q5: How do local laws affect window tinting costs?
A5: State laws dictate legal VLT percentages, limiting tint options and potentially affecting the overall cost.
Q6: What is VLT (Visible Light Transmission)?
A6: VLT refers to the percentage of visible light that can pass through the tinted window, regulated by state laws.
Q7: How does the complexity of the window affect tinting costs?
A7: Complex windows require more time and skill to tint, increasing labor costs.
Q8: What is the best type of window tint for heat rejection?
A8: Ceramic window tint is the best for heat rejection due to its advanced technology and non-conductive properties.
Q9: Does window tinting affect cell phone signals?
A9: Non-metallic tints like ceramic and carbon do not interfere with cell phone signals.
Q10: How can I find a reputable window tint shop near me?
A10: Check online reviews, ask for recommendations, and compare quotes from multiple shops to find a reputable tinter.
